Position: Training Coordinator I
Location: 508 Georgia Highway 138 SW, Riverdale, GA 30274
Duration: 4 Months
Client: Southern Company Services
Job Summary
Southern Company Services is seeking a Training Coordinator I to support training operations, learning management system administration, training records, reporting, and coordination activities.
This role helps ensure training programs are delivered accurately, efficiently, and on schedule. The Training Coordinator will maintain learning data, support course and class setup, monitor compliance-related training records, resolve routine system or process issues, and coordinate with internal stakeholders.
The ideal candidate is self-directed, solution-oriented, organized, and comfortable managing multiple priorities with limited supervision.
Key Responsibilities
· Support day-to-day training operations and administrative activities.
· Administer learning management system functions, including course, curriculum, class, and user-record maintenance.
· Create and update courses, classes, rosters, assignments, and completion records.
· Maintain accurate employee and contractor training records.
· Monitor compliance-related training requirements and identify missing, overdue, or inaccurate records.
· Generate training reports, dashboards, completion summaries, and data analyses.
· Review learning data for accuracy and resolve routine system or process discrepancies.
· Coordinate training schedules, logistics, communications, materials, and attendance.
· Work closely with training delivery teams, instructional designers, operations partners, and other stakeholders.
· Respond to employee and contractor questions regarding course assignments, completions, and training records.
· Identify opportunities to improve training administration processes and data quality.
· Document procedures, recurring issues, resolutions, and process improvements.
· Manage assigned work independently and escalate complex issues when necessary.
